What Types of Work and Facilities Can Home Health Physical Therapists Expect in Portsmouth, NH?

As a Home Health Physical Therapist in Portsmouth, New Hampshire, you will have the unique opportunity to work with a diverse patient population in their own homes, focusing on rehabilitation and mobility improvement. Your responsibilities will include conducting comprehensive assessments, developing individualized treatment plans, and providing hands-on therapy to help patients recover from surgeries, neurological conditions, or chronic pain. In this assignment, you will provide skilled home health physical therapy services to adult and geriatric patients within their homes throughout Marlborough and nearby communities. You will conduct comprehensive evaluations, develop individualized plans of care, and deliver therapeutic interventions focused on improving mobility, strength, balance, and safety in the home environment. You will also play a key role in patient and caregiver education, emphasizing fall prevention, safe transfer techniques, home exercise programs, and strategies to promote independence. A typical day involves traveling between patient homes, managing a case load that may include post-acute patients discharged from hospitals or rehab facilities, individuals with chronic conditions, and patients requiring rehabilitation after orthopedic or neurological events. You will collaborate closely with an interdisciplinary team that may include nursing, occupational therapy, speech therapy, and social work to coordinate care and support optimal patient outcomes. Documentation is completed electronically, and you will be expected to maintain timely and accurate records in alignment with home health regulations and agency protocols. In this position, you will provide one-on-one skilled physical therapy in patients’ homes throughout Elizabethtown and surrounding communities. Typical responsibilities include performing comprehensive assessments, developing individualized care plans, implementing therapeutic exercise and mobility programs, educating patients and caregivers, and evaluating home safety to reduce fall risk. You will manage a caseload that can include post-acute, orthopedic, neurological, cardiopulmonary, and chronic disease patients, focusing on functional improvement, independence, and quality of life. Your day will involve traveling between patient residences, completing timely documentation, and coordinating with an interdisciplinary team that may include nursing, occupational therapy, speech therapy, social work, and home health aides. Visit volumes are structured to balance productivity with safe, high-quality care and adequate documentation time. You will use an electronic medical record system and mobile technology to streamline charting and communication while in the field. The home health environment offers a high degree of professional autonomy and allows you to see the direct impact of your interventions in the patient’s own setting. You will often work closely with families and caregivers, tailoring interventions to the home environment and prioritizing practical, functional goals that matter most to patients.
